AT91 SAM7 Basic USB Project

	  The goal of this demonstration project is to demonstrate how to use the AT91 ARM-Based 
	Software Package. This project runs a test of the AT91SAM7Sxx device and his corresponding
	Evaluation Kit, the AT91SAM7Sxx-EK. This project implements a USB communication using the 
	on-chip USB device with a PC application.

Install 

	  Please copy atmusb6124.inf in the following windows directory C:\WINxx\inf directory and 
	atmusb6124.sys in the following windows directory C:\WINxx\system32\drivers directory. When
	the USB device is connected for the first time, the PC host asks for a driver installation 
	file (.inf file). atmusb6124.sys driver will be associated to this device. The BasicUSB_6124.exe
	PC application is then ready to communicate:

	C:\ BasicUSB_6124.exe

	This will transmit buffer every second to each connected device.

Quick description

	This device uses 3 pipes associated with physical endpoints:
	·         EP0 Control endpoint
	·         EP1 Bulk IN endpoint
	·         EP2 Bulk Out endpoint

During the initialization, 

	·         The peripheral clock must be enabled for the USB device and the 48MHz PLL USB clock.
	·         Pipe objects are then initialized and the dispatch routine is associated with the 
		   control pipe
	·         The pull-up on USB DP line is finally activated


Once the device is plugged and the enumeration phase completed, the application reads data from the USB
host and sends back a packet through the DBGU. After ten seconds with any connected device found, the
PC application stops sending packet.
